Though South Milford Station lacks a ticket office, the convenience of ticket machines means you're never left without a way to purchase or collect tickets. These machines are accessible to everyone, ensuring an inclusive and hassle-free experience. Smartcards are available for more tech-savvy travelers, complete with validation points for easy usage. With step-free access to most areas, the station is classified as a Category B station, indicating partial accessibility, which might require assistance to access some parts.
While at the station, you'll find the basics covered in terms of informational support. There are departure screens and regular announcements to keep you informed. While there isn't always staff assistance available, a customer help point ensures that help is close by, whenever necessary. Moreover, CCTV coverage offers an added layer of security, so you'll always feel safe.
South Milford extends its connectivity with numerous transport links. Rail replacement services are conveniently located at the bus stops on Milford Road for those unforeseen disruptions. For local travel, there's a bus stop near the station, and Busline can be contacted at 0871 200 2233 for details on schedules and routes. If taxis are more your style, head over to Northern Railway's cab service for options.
Although bicycle hire isn't available at the station, enthusiasts will be pleased to know that storage stands for bicycles are present within the car park, shielded from weather, ensuring your bike's safety. CCTV in the area further bolsters security. If you're driving, the car park extends 30 spaces with a nominal parking fee, plus a few dedicated spots for accessible parking.

Ardrossan Harbour Station is ideal for travelers seeking simplicity; the station lacks a ticket office and machines, so tickets need to be purchased in advance or online before travel. However, rest assured that smartcard validators are available, adding a touch of digital convenience.
Accessibility is a highlight here. The station boasts step-free access throughout, providing ease for everyone venturing through the station. Also notable are customer help points and the absence of gates, allowing smooth, uninterrupted movement. While waiting facilities might be limited to a seating area, the station compensates with operational CCTV for a secure environment.
Journeying beyond Ardrossan Harbour is a breeze with diverse transport links. In case of rail disruptions, a rail replacement service operates at the Ferry Terminal car park - further details can be explored via what3words. If road transport suits you better, check out Train Taxi to secure a ride. Bus services are abundant with schedules available on Traveline Scotland or by calling 0871 200 22 33 any time, day or night.
